Successful Treatment of Small Intestinal Bleeding in a Crohn’s Patient with Noncirrhotic Portal Hypertension by Transjugular Portosystemic Shunt Placement and Infliximab Treatment

Small intestinal bleeding in Crohn’s disease patients with noncirrhotic portal hypertension and partial portal and superior mesenteric vein thrombosis is a life-threatening event.
